Comfort at Stake: Aging HVAC and Mechanical Systems

Mechanical systems do the heavy lifting of daily life. In older buildings, heating and cooling equipment often runs on borrowed time. Efficiency slips while components wear and calibration drifts. Some units rely on parts that are no longer widely manufactured, which turns a simple repair into a scavenger hunt. Tenants notice discomfort right away. One room runs cool while another stays stuffy. Airflow feels weak. Vents rattle. Thermostats seem indecisive.

This is where specialized commercial HVAC service is essential. Technicians trained on legacy equipment can track subtle symptoms and prevent cascading failures. Weak airflow can flag a failing blower. Uneven temperatures may reveal duct leakage or zoning problems. Small refrigerant leaks often explain erratic cooling, and minor water in the mechanical room can hint at condensate issues. Routine inspections, filter changes, coil cleaning, and belt checks extend service life. Even better, they lower complaint volume and keep common spaces comfortable during seasonal temperature swings.

Plumbing That Never Sleeps

Water has a way of telling on a building. Old pipes develop scale and corrosion that constrict flow. Fixtures crack without warning. Joints drip invisibly behind a wall until a ceiling stain or a warped floor announces the problem. A slow drain rarely stays confined to one apartment. In many older properties, recurring clogs signal deeper blockages in stacked lines or the main.

These patterns need discipline. List-based walkthroughs spot little issues early. Look for discoloration around supply lines, soft drywall, bubbling paint, sink dampness, or persistent odors. Occasionally hot and cold cycling indicates valve aging, whereas low water pressure indicates accumulation. Maintenance crews may map concerns to risers and routes, identify recurrent problem sites, and plan multi-unit repairs by routinely logging observations. Maintenance and cleaning may seem regular, yet they reduce emergency and after-hours calls.

Power Demands in a Digital Age

Old electrical systems were not intended for modern life. Tenants now use laptops, gaming consoles, smart TVs, air purifiers, and chargers simultaneously. Unupgraded wiring and panels cause breakers to trip under loads inconceivable when the building opened. Outlets may be few or loose. Risky temporary fixes include octopus extension cords.

Methodical electrical reviews go beyond compliance. Keeps people protected. Check panels for heat and capacity deficits. Check outlets for grounding and replace wobbling or sparking ones. Find circuits with too many devices. Aluminum branch wiring and outdated fabric insulation in some buildings need professional repair. Kitchens and living areas with the most use are upgraded when possible. This investment avoids trips and cord overheating behind furniture.

Everyday Wear in Units and Common Spaces

Surfaces tell the truth about daily use. Hallway paint dulls, trim chips, and stair treads loosen. Doors swell and stick through seasons. Window seals lose their grip, inviting drafts and moisture. In apartments with frequent turnover, cabinet hinges strain and counters scar. Appliances soldier on past their prime and start to sound tired.

Small, regular repair days hold the line. Tighten hardware. Patch and paint with durable finishes matched to high traffic areas. Re-seat thresholds and adjust door closers. Reseal windows but also address framing if rot creeps in. These touchups seem simple, yet they shape how residents feel about their home. Care reflects back. When tenants see maintenance in motion, they report issues sooner and treat spaces with more respect.

Roofs and Exteriors: Silent Sources of Damage

From the sidewalk, a roof can look fine and still harbor trouble. Time wears on membranes, flashing, and seams. Minor cracks let water travel in unpredictable paths, and by the time a stain appears inside, the leak has already wandered. Gutters clog and push water toward foundations. Siding fades and traps moisture behind compromised caulking.

Proactive exterior work prevents expensive surprises. Twice-yearly roof checks catch loose fasteners, blistering, and soft spots that foretell leaks. After storms, walk the perimeter. Look for displaced shingles, standing water near downspouts, and deteriorated sealant around penetrations. On facades, pay attention to paint failure and hairline cracks that invite moisture intrusion. Drainage around the property matters just as much. Redirecting water away from the building keeps basements dry and preserves structural elements that do not announce their vulnerabilities until damage is advanced.

Compliance That Moves Faster Than Buildings

Safety standards evolve, and older buildings must evolve with them. Fire alarm systems age out and require updates. Emergency lighting fails quietly and needs regular testing. Ventilation standards change, especially in high-occupancy spaces. Elevators demand inspections that keep them reliable, while older boilers face more frequent scrutiny.

A yearly code and safety review gives structure to all of this. Map required inspections. Verify test logs. Audit life safety devices floor by floor. Plan the upgrades needed to meet current requirements rather than patching the minimum. Taken together, these steps protect residents and shield owners from penalties. More importantly, they establish a rhythm that integrates safety into daily operations.

Costs That Climb and Budgets That Flex

Maintenance costs rise as buildings age. Components fail more often, and specialty parts for legacy systems command premiums. Some needs cannot be delayed, like roof replacement or riser repairs. Without a financial plan, urgent issues can stall or force corner cutting that costs more later.

Flexible budgeting makes the difference. Build a reserve for reactive work alongside a schedule for capital projects. Track spending by system so trends are visible. When one category spikes, you can forecast future needs and adjust other timelines. Vendor relationships help too. Service agreements stabilize pricing and provide priority response. Transparent communication with owners about realistic lifecycles prevents sticker shock when a repair crosses the line into replacement.

What are the earliest signs that an HVAC system in an older building is struggling?

Subtle temperature swings across rooms often appear first, followed by reduced airflow at vents. You might notice longer run times without reaching set points, higher utility bills that do not match weather shifts, or condensate around equipment. Strange vibrations or rattling indicate worn belts or fans, while musty smells can mean dirty coils or duct issues.

What electrical upgrades most effectively reduce nuisance breaker trips?

Increasing panel capacity where feasible and redistributing circuits to balance loads helps significantly. Replacing worn outlets, adding grounded receptacles in high-use areas, and addressing loose connections reduce heat and arcing. In some cases, upgrading old wiring and installing modern protective devices improves reliability and safety across entire floors.

How frequently should roofs and exterior systems be evaluated?

Plan two comprehensive roof inspections each year and add checks after severe weather. Walk exteriors seasonally to assess paint, sealants, siding, and drainage. Clean gutters regularly, verify downspout extensions, and inspect foundation areas for pooling water. Early attention to small defects prevents widespread water intrusion.

What steps help older buildings stay aligned with current safety and compliance standards?

Maintain a calendar of required inspections and tests, document results, and act promptly on deficiencies. Review fire alarm coverage and emergency lighting performance annually. Confirm ventilation effectiveness in common areas, and keep elevator and boiler service up to date. Where code changes apply, set upgrade timelines rather than relying on temporary fixes.

How can property managers plan for rising maintenance costs without derailing operations?

Develop a reserve fund dedicated to unexpected repairs and a capital plan for predictable replacements. Track expenditures by system to identify patterns and forecast upcoming needs. Use service contracts to stabilize pricing and response times, and communicate clearly with owners about lifecycle realities so major projects receive timely approval.
